Highlights & Details
High leverage diagonal cutters
- For heavy-duty, continuous use
- High cutting power with low application of force through optimum matching of cutting angle and transmission ratio
- Precision cutting edges additionally induction hardened, cutting edge hardness approx. 64 HRC) for all sorts of wire, including piano wire
- Chrome-vanadium high speed steel, forged, oil-hardened multi-level
